How do I hook two computers up to one internet service.?

Here's the deal, we have two computers set up beside each other and we want to be able to access our internet account from either one. I don't necessarily need to share files from one to the other, only have it set up to that I can be on the www researching something and hubby can also do what he needs to do on the net from his separate computer. We do have a router, which we've never hooked up, for lack of knowledge on how to do so? Please any help would be grand. Not much info on your connection, but here goes nothing. You need to set up a network with that router of yours. It takes cables called Ethernet cables, and they plug into Network Interface Cards or NICs for short on each computer. If you have a broadband modem (cable or DSL), that also plugs into the router, usually on port 1 or the port that is separate from the others. Now run the Network Setup Wizard in the Windows Control Panel on BOTH computers and you should be able to connect both to the internet at the same time.
